# Running dbt Commands
## Preferences
1. **Use MCP tools if available** (`dbt_build`, `dbt_run`, `dbt_show`, etc.) - they handle paths, timeouts, and formatting automatically
2. **Always use `build` — even when users say "run"** - When a user asks to "run" a model, recommend `dbt build` instead. `build` = `run` + `test` in one step, so it catches data quality issues immediately. `dbt run` alone is almost never the right answer during development.
3. **Always use `--quiet`** with `--warn-error-options '{"error": ["NoNodesForSelectionCriteria"]}'` to reduce output while catching selector typos
4. **Always use `--select`** - never run the entire project without explicit user approval
## Quick Reference
```bash
# Standard command pattern
dbt build --select my_model --quiet --warn-error-options '{"error": ["NoNodesForSelectionCriteria"]}'
# Preview model output
dbt show --select my_model --limit 10
